Company Profile
Bill Express Limited is engaged in the management and development of an electronic distribution system for pre-paid products and services across in excess of 14,000 locations around Australia, automated ordering, delivery and inventory control for pre-paid services including mobile, landline and Internet services. It also processes payments for bills and services, including bills that are presented for payment to its outlets across Australia. The Company has an in-store media, which is a network that promotes Bill Express Limited's and other products at the point of sale and in-store aisles.
